Join the fun! This introduction to salsa is for students with little or no salsa dance experience. You don't need a partner to join!
You will learn the four basic steps: ladies’ and men’s right turn; cross body lead, including timing and the importance of leading/following technique.
Each class builds progressively with a class structure of 15 min. review/15 min. new material/15 min. practice/15 min. dance to music.

8-9pm Shines and Body Movement
9-9:30pm Work on intensive partnerwork technique in the following areas:
Phase 1-Latin Dance Movement: Use knees, hips, ribcage, arms (whole body movement) in a basic step. Add shines in turn patterns while focusing on Leading & Following and basic turn pattern technique.
January - March 31st.
Phase 2-Core Moves: Use the 10 core moves from the GoDanceMambo syllabus while adding body and arm styling on each one, including body waves. Men learn 3 options on each of the 10 moves, including dips.
April 7-(noJune 30) July 7
Phase 3-Spin technique: Individual technique working on balance, spotting, frame. Partnerwork: On the spot doubles, triples, travelling turns, S turns, axel turns, wrap turns, natural top and spins that turn into dips.
